Bounce Back

01 May 2008

Powered access equipment manufacturer Pinguely—Haulotte saw its sales rise +30% in 2004 to €285,8 million. Full results will be announced in March, but the company says it achieved a 5% net profit margin and is expecting +15% to +20% sales growth this year.
